Overview
The TSC S5X06-03-S0-12-1P is a mobile handheld RFID printer engineered for field operations where wireless connectivity and real-time label printing are essential. This compact device combines RFID encoding capability with mobile printing functionality, delivering portable labeling solutions for logistics, inventory management, asset tracking, and field service applications. The unit features Wi-Fi connectivity for seamless network integration and includes a touchscreen display for intuitive operation in challenging environments.
Key Features
- RFID Capability: Integrated RFID technology for encoding and printing RFID-enabled labels and tags in real-time, supporting mobile asset tracking and inventory workflows
- Wi-Fi Connectivity: Wireless network access eliminates cable constraints, enabling deployment across warehouse floors, distribution centers, and field locations
- Touchscreen Display: Color touchscreen interface provides operator-friendly navigation and status monitoring for mobile printing tasks
- Portable Form Factor: Designed for handheld and mobile mounting configurations, supporting on-the-go printing without desktop infrastructure
- On-Site Service Included: 1-year on-site service provision ensures rapid support response and minimizes downtime during deployment
- Field-Ready Design: Rugged construction suitable for warehouse, distribution, retail, and logistics environments
Integration & Compatibility
The S5X06-03-S0-12-1P integrates into existing mobile printing and RFID infrastructure via Wi-Fi. Its touchscreen interface supports quick configuration and label template management without requiring connected workstations. The device is compatible with standard label design software and RFID encoding workflows, making it suitable for integration into inventory management systems, mobile asset tracking platforms, and field service dispatch applications.
Service & Support
This configuration includes a 1-year on-site service agreement, meaning TSC-authorized technicians will respond to hardware failures at your location, reducing logistics overhead for equipment replacement or repair. This is particularly valuable for mission-critical mobile printing operations where downtime directly impacts field team productivity.

I've evaluated the S5X06-03-S0-12-1P during field deployment planning for warehouse modernization projects. This device fills a specific niche: organizations that need mobile RFID encoding without carrying a full-featured mobile computer or deploying multiple stationary printers across a facility. The Wi-Fi connectivity is essential—it eliminates the cable-and-dock constraints that slow down mobile workflows, and the touchscreen makes it genuinely usable in the field without requiring a paired tablet or smartphone.
Technical Highlights:
- RFID Integration: The built-in RFID capability means you encode and print in one operation; no separate RFID writer needed at the point of labeling
- Wireless Operation: Wi-Fi connectivity provides real-time database lookups and label template access, which is critical for accuracy in high-velocity fulfillment operations
Deployment Considerations:
- Confirm Wi-Fi signal coverage in your deployment zones before purchase; dead spots will force fallback to offline mode, limiting functionality
- The 1-year on-site service is valuable insurance; allocate budget for extended service if the device will be in critical daily use beyond year one
The S5X06-03-S0-12-1P works best in organizations that have already standardized on wireless infrastructure and RFID labeling processes. It's not a replacement for desktop printers, but it's a strong fit for mobile-first operations in logistics, retail distribution, and field service environments.
